Coconut Oils Tested for Toxic Phthalates — Buying Guide

June 03, 2025 | Source: Mamavation | by Leah Segedie

Which coconut oils have the least phthalate contamination? Phthalates are hormone-disrupting chemicals in plastics that find their way into many foods and personal care products. To solve this puzzle, Mamavation sent several of the most popular coconut oils off to an EPA-certified laboratory to test for several types of phthalates to find out.
